<p>I showed the <strong>Hanukkah animation</strong> to my two sons as my husband&#8217;s family are Jewish and I wanted them to give the boys an understanding of what the festival is all about. Following on from that I took my youngest son into Oxford at the start of the week to see the twelve foot high Hannukah menorah (sometimes called a hannukiah) that currently stands in Broad Street and is illuminated each evening up to the end of the eight night festival. I thought this was particularly impressive until I saw <a href="http://www.abstractavr.com/newsstories/menorah/">this one</a> which is currently residing in Trafalgar Square.</p>
<div id="attachment_1515" class="wp-caption aligncenter" style="width: 235px"><a href="http://knowledgebox.files.wordpress.com/2009/12/img_0114.jpg"><img class="size-medium wp-image-1515" title="IMG_0114" src="http://knowledgebox.files.wordpress.com/2009/12/img_0114.jpg?w=225&#038;h=300" alt="" width="225" height="300"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Taking a closer look.....</p></div>
<p>My children are still quite young and there is a lot to understand so I asked members of our family what Hanukkah meant to them as children.</p>
<p>My husband took some time to recall and then came back with these thoughts:</p>
<p><em>The candelabra that remained unused all year suddenly became the centre of attention for those special eight days of the year, and as children we all wanted to do was light it each evening. The story of Hanukkah tells of resistance and bravery, what better way to celebrate this than with laktas (potato pancakes) and beef brisket. And most importantly Grandpa always left large bars of chocolate for all of us.</em></p>
<p>And my sister-in-law didn&#8217;t really have particular Hanukkah memories to draw on but is now celebrating the holiday with her own children over in Guernsey. Each night they light the candles and say the blessings. And <strong>every</strong> night there is a small present for each of them (although it is rumoured that the presents ran out by the third day&#8230;)</p>

<p>In a week where it seems to be dark as early as 4 pm and the roads are covered in wet leaves, the importance of Road Safety becomes even more obvious.</p>
<p>If you do a have a bit more time to work with this theme, then you could use it as an opportunity to do some really interesting science work about <a href="http://www.bbc.co.uk/schools/ks2bitesize/science/physical_processes/" target="_blank"><strong>forces and friction</strong></a><strong>.</strong> Discuss the effect that wet leaves have on friction, experiment with different lubricants when trying to move objects down a slope, look at ways in which we try to increase friction ( e.g. car tyre treads) and situations where we want and don&#8217;t want friction.</p>

<p>There are some great cross-curricular ideas in the Teacher notes for things you might like to do with your children and here are just a few:</p>
<p><strong>The Emperor&#8217;s wardrobe:</strong> <em>Literacy opportunity</em><br />
Pause on the section of the animation that shows the Emperor&#8217;s wardrobe. Look closely at the clothes in the wardrobe. What do they tell you about the Emperor? You could ask the children to choose one of the outfits and to imagine what happened the day it was worn by the Emperor.</p>
<p><strong>Character passports: </strong><em>Literacy opportunity</p>
<p></em>Encourage children to brainstorm a list of words to describe each character from the story. Then ask the children to create a passport for one of the characters from the story. They should draw a picture of the character and fill in the following sections: Name, Age, Address, and Description.<strong></strong></p>
<p><strong>Pretend to be tailors: </strong><em>Mathematics opportunity</p>
<p></em>Give the children measuring tapes and ask them to work in pairs (one is the tailor and the other is the Emperor) measuring each other. They should make accurate measurements of different body parts and should record and compare the measurements.</p>
<p><strong>Being different: </strong><em>PSHE opportunity</em></p>
<ul>
<li>Ask the children if they have ever pretended to understand something because they didn’t want to stand out and be different. Discuss the disadvantages of doing this.</li>
<li>Talk about how it feels to stand out from the crowd. Discuss situations where individual pupils have done this and how they have felt.</li>
<li>How do they think the Emperor felt when the crowd was laughing at him? Talk about how it feels to be laughed at.</li>
<li>Do the children think that what happened at the end of the story was fair?</li>
</ul>

<p>The activity ideas for use with Persephone include:</p>
<ul>
<li><strong>Settings-The underworld</strong>  <em>Literacy and Art and design opportunity</em><br />
Ask pupils to brainstorm a list of words to describe the underworld. Encourage them to<br />
write a poem about this place or to paint a picture.</li>
<li><strong>Grecian urn: </strong><em>Art and design opportunity</em><br />
Draw a scene from the myth to illustrate the side of a Grecian urn.</li>
<li><strong>Gods and Goddesses in art</strong> <em>Art and design opportunity</em><br />
Use books and the internet to research how the Gods and Goddesses who feature in this<br />
myth are represented in paintings and sculptures.</li>
<li><strong>Write a myth </strong><em>Literacy opportunity</em><br />
Encourage pupils to write their own myth to explain an aspect of nature e.g. how day<br />
and night came to be. Encourage them to use characters they already know from Greek<br />
mythology and to create characters of their own. </li>
</ul>
